Factors Influencing Footage Retention:
Several factors interact to determine how long your security camera system retains footage. These include:
Storage Capacity: The most fundamental factor is the available hard drive space in your DVR/NVR. Larger hard drives naturally allow for longer recording periods. Consider the resolution (e.g., 1080p, 4K) and frame rate of your cameras; higher resolutions and frame rates consume significantly more storage space. A 1TB hard drive might only store a few days of high-resolution footage from multiple cameras, while a larger 8TB drive could store weeks or even months.
Recording Mode: Your DVR/NVR offers various recording modes significantly impacting storage usage. These modes include:
Continuous Recording: This mode continuously records footage, even without motion detection. It consumes the most storage space but provides a complete record of all activity. It's ideal for applications requiring thorough surveillance.
Motion Detection Recording: This mode only records when motion is detected. It significantly saves storage space compared to continuous recording but might miss events that occur without triggering motion detection. Fine-tuning motion detection sensitivity is crucial to balance storage and event capture.
Schedule-Based Recording: This allows you to specify recording times. For example, you might only record during business hours or overnight. This mode provides excellent storage optimization when combined with motion detection.
Hybrid Recording: Some systems allow a combination of these modes. You might have continuous recording during specific high-risk periods and motion detection recording at other times.
Number of Cameras: The more cameras in your system, the faster you'll fill up your hard drive. Each camera contributes to the overall storage consumption.
Camera Resolution and Frame Rate: Higher resolutions (e.g., 4K) and faster frame rates (e.g., 60fps) consume significantly more storage space than lower resolutions and frame rates (e.g., 720p, 30fps).
Compression Type: DVR/NVRs use video compression codecs (like H.264, H.265/HEVC) to reduce file sizes. H.265/HEVC offers better compression than H.264, resulting in longer recording times for the same storage capacity.
Setting Up Your Recording Schedule:
The specific steps to configure your recording schedule depend on your DVR/NVR's manufacturer and model. However, the general process typically involves accessing the DVR/NVR's user interface (usually through a web browser or dedicated software) and navigating to the settings or configuration menu. Look for options related to:
Recording Mode Selection: Choose the recording mode(s) best suited to your needs (continuous, motion detection, schedule-based, or a hybrid approach).
Motion Detection Sensitivity: Adjust the sensitivity of your motion detection to minimize false alarms and optimize storage usage. Too sensitive a setting will fill your storage quickly with irrelevant recordings.
Recording Schedule: Define specific days and times for recording. If you only need coverage during certain hours, tailor your schedule accordingly.
Overwrite Settings: Configure how the system handles storage space when it's full. The most common option is to overwrite the oldest footage, ensuring continuous recording.
Hard Drive Monitoring: Regularly monitor your hard drive space to prevent unexpected storage full conditions. Most DVR/NVR systems provide alerts when storage space is low.
Choosing the Right Storage Solution:
To extend your footage retention, consider these factors:
Upgrade Hard Drives: Install larger capacity hard drives to accommodate longer recording times. Ensure your DVR/NVR supports the drive size and type.
Network Attached Storage (NAS): For larger systems or extended retention needs, a NAS device can provide significantly more storage than a single DVR/NVR hard drive. Many NVRs support network storage.
Cloud Storage: Some systems offer cloud storage options, allowing you to upload recordings to a remote server. This adds redundancy and potentially extends your retention period. However, cloud storage usually incurs ongoing subscription fees.
Security Considerations:
Remember that extended footage retention also increases your responsibility for data security. Ensure your system is properly secured with strong passwords and access controls to protect sensitive recordings. Consider the legal and ethical implications of storing video data for extended periods.
